Best Time to Visit Los Cabos

The Short Answer

Los Cabos is a year-round destination — it receives roughly 350 days of sunshine annually, and the rain that does fall mostly comes in brief late-summer bursts. But the best time to visit depends on what matters most to you: weather quality, whale watching, hotel prices, crowd levels, or specific activities.

Here's the honest breakdown.


The Two Main Seasons

Peak Season: November – April

This is when Los Cabos is at its most comfortable and most crowded. Temperatures hover between 70–80°F (21–27°C), humidity is low, the water is clear, and there's virtually no rain. Whale watching season (December–April) runs through most of this window, making January and February especially popular.

The trade-off: hotel prices are at their highest, popular excursions book up quickly, and the marina can feel crowded during Christmas week, spring break, and Easter. If you're traveling in peak season, book 2–3 months ahead for luxury properties.

Value Season: May – October

Hotel rates drop 30–50% from peak season. Beaches are less crowded. The summer months (June–August) bring warmer air temperatures (85–92°F / 29–33°C) and warmer water — excellent for snorkeling and diving. Marlin and dorado fishing peaks in this window too.

The caveat: September is hurricane season, and Los Cabos has been affected in the past (most notably by Hurricane Odile in 2014 and Hurricane Norma in 2023). Risks are real but manageable — most travel insurance policies cover tropical storms, and most travelers who visit in September or October have no issues. Just be aware and plan accordingly.

💡 Sweet Spot: November and early December offer the best of both worlds — comfortable temperatures, declining summer crowds, pre-holiday pricing, and the beginning of whale season. Many experienced Cabo travelers consider this the optimal window.


Month-by-Month Breakdown

Month Temp Rain Crowds Rates Highlights
January 72°F / 22°C Dry High Peak Whale watching begins, ideal weather
February 72°F / 22°C Dry High Peak Peak whale watching, Valentine's week busy
March 74°F / 23°C Dry Very High Peak Spring break crowds, perfect beach weather
April 76°F / 24°C Dry High Peak Easter week, last of whale season
May 80°F / 27°C Minimal Low Value Great weather, low crowds, sport fishing starts
June 85°F / 29°C Low Low Value Warm water, excellent snorkeling and diving
July 89°F / 32°C Low Medium Shoulder Peak marlin season, family travel picks up
August 91°F / 33°C Moderate Medium Shoulder Hot, occasional storms, peak marlin and dorado
September 89°F / 32°C High Very Low Value Hurricane season — lowest prices, highest risk
October 85°F / 29°C Moderate Low Value Calmer weather returns, uncrowded beaches
November 78°F / 26°C Minimal Medium Shoulder Sweet spot month — great weather, fair rates
December 74°F / 23°C Dry Very High Peak Holiday week is extremely busy and expensive

Best Time to Visit by Travel Type

Honeymoons & Romance

January and February offer the ideal combination: perfect weather, active whale season (watching whales from a chartered yacht is a remarkable honeymoon experience), and the full range of romantic resort experiences. November is an excellent budget-friendly alternative.

Families

March and April (outside of spring break week if possible) or July for summer holidays. The warm, calm Sea of Cortez water in summer is great for kids learning to snorkel. Avoid the specific spring break and Christmas/New Year's peaks if you want manageable crowds.

Sport Fishing

May through November is when Cabo's fishing is at its world-class best. Marlin and dorado peak in summer (June–September), with blue marlin running strong through October.

Budget Travelers

May, early June, or October offer the best value: decent weather, significantly reduced rates, and far fewer crowds. Avoid September unless you're experienced with tropical weather and have flexible travel insurance.
